Kenyans Congratulate Gospel Singer And TV Host Kambua

Many famous people have today joined Kenyans in commending news that gospel vocalist and TV star as she is expectant.

From Papa Shirandula’s Jacky Vike, artist DK Kwenye Beat, spinner Dj Mo to radio moderator Mwende Macharia, messages of generosity have been pouring in after Kambua posted a photograph spouting over her big baby bump.

In 2018, the ‘Nishikilie’ singer narrated to Amina Abdi her anguish on being asked frequently why she was yet to get children six years after getting married to Jackson Mathu.

“Today I saw a comment and deleted it because this guy commented on my Instagram and he says ‘When are you going to get pregnant, you’re getting old. I remember thinking, the reason why it angers me is because people don’t even know what your journey is like. They don’t know what you’re struggling with.

“They don’t know if you even want to have children. They don’t know if you can have children and there are so many people especially today who are struggling with infertility. It so unfortunate that we become such a culture of being so intrusive and putting people down,” said Kambua.

Her splendid garden wedding took place at the grand Windsor Golf hotel and was befittingly dubbed as 2012’s wedding of the year.
